Abstract
LONG-TERM GOALS: The main goal is to establish a nowcast system for regional seas, including the South China Sea. This system will have the capability of diagnosing three dimensional velocity, temperature, and salinity fields from satellite and sparse in-situ observations. This system will be easily embedded into the prediction system (e.g., Princeton Ocean Model). The combined nowcast/forecast system will greatly enhance existing operational capability.
